- [ ] Verify the queue-depth autoscaler config for Lanternflow is sealed before the ceremony proceeds. Confirm the scaler's max-replica ceiling matches the value approved in the Drexel review, and that the scale-down cooldown is 300s, not the old 120s default. Once both witnesses sign the ledger, the ceremony lead rotates the autoscaler's control credentials and escrows them with the Marrowvale custodial team. The escrow record must carry the passphrase immediately below this item.

vault phrase of yagag-kadup = belael-druius-rusax-kelox

The humidity probes drift upward roughly 2% per month; the controller compensates with a rolling calibration window of 14 days. Do not shorten this window — shorter windows overfit to irrigation cycles and cause the vents to oscillate. Temperature sensors are stable and need no correction. Recalibration runs Sundays at 03:00 local; failures page the farm-ops rotation. Before touching calibration constants, read the drift model write-up, which lives on the internal page below.

runbook for badug-kadup: https://confluence.zemvarlabs.internal/projects/browse/display/projects/bd1b

09:14 — Parcel-tracking webhook from the Corvane hub began returning 410s. Retries exhausted by 09:20; downstream status pages went stale. Root cause: endpoint rotated during the Fennwick cutover, subscription not updated. Re-registered at 09:37, backfilled events by 09:52. The deploy active during the rotation is identified by the token below.

trace token, fafog-kageg: htk4_98e6

Ticket: DEDUP-412 — Connection failures during customer record dedup

The Larkspur dedup job started failing overnight with pool exhaustion errors. It merges duplicate customer records in batches of 500, but the batch worker isn't releasing connections after a merge conflict, so the pool drains within twenty minutes. Proposed fix: wrap merges in a try/finally release and cap retries at three. For the sync, reproduce against staging using the connection string below.

primary connection of bagep-kaweg = clickhouse://rusdor_svc:3TXlgH7O8DuUYI@db-ae3f.zarqelgrid.internal:5432/zordor